The scope of the audit services include but not limited to the following:
i. Carry out desk study of relevant contract documents
ii. Evaluation of quality and quantity of work done determine whether the work performed represent true value of money spent.
iii. Review the procurement process to check whether proper procurement procedures were adhered to, if not what were the reasons.
iv. Assess adequacy of the contract documents used.
v. Assess if factors contributing to poor quality, delays and cost overruns are properly recorded, analyzed appropriately and promptly acted upon.
vi. Check whether payments to sub-contractors are done according to laid down procedures.
vii. Assess bottleneck encountered and capacity of implementing team in executing the works and advice on remedial measures.
viii. Visit the project sites and inspect the works.
ix. During site visits the Consultant may be required to conduct field tests in order to ascertain the quality.
x. Examine the circumstances which may lead to disputes in the course of execution of the works and advice the client on the best way forward to mitigate the situations.
